Petition for Barcelona City Council to continue removing fascist symbols

The Sindicatura de Greuges de Barcelona has asked Barcelona City Council to continue removing fascist symbols from public spaces that began in 2015, under the protection of Law 20/2022 on Democratic Memory.

The institution has also recommended that the City Council make public the census of elements to be removed, a proposal that is expected to be ready in June 2024, as explained by the Audit Office in a statement.

On the other hand, the Ombudsman defends that the convenience of establishing a channel so that citizens can communicate the detection of fascist symbols that do not appear in the census prepared by the City Council should be considered.

Law 20/2022 on Democratic Memory determines that the General Administration of the State, with the collaboration of the rest of the administrations, must prepare a catalog of

symbols and elements contrary to democratic memory. "Although this catalog is not yet available, it will allow administrations to improve their protocols and have a more comprehensive vision of their task," concludes the Audit Office.
